Best Value Sports Management Schools For Those Making $48-$75k

With all of the options students have for higher education today, it can be tough to choose which direction to take. College Factual has developed its “Best Value Sports Management Schools For Those Making $48-$75k” ranking as one item you can use to help make this decision.

Sports Management is the 48th most popular major in the country with 16,971 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

This year’s “Best Value Sports Management Schools For Those Making $48-$75k” ranking looked at 308 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in sports management.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ality sports management program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.

Some of the factors we look at when determining these rankings are overall quality of the sports management program at the school and the cost of the school after aid is awarded among other things. See our ranking methodology to learn more.
